1. A method for determining the number of a plurality of objects in a working volume, the method comprising:

  • determining a first planar projection of a first visual hull of the plurality of objects, the planar projection comprising a first set of one or more shapes; and

    determining a first set of one or more lower bounds, a lower bound being associated with a shape in the first set of one or more shapes, a lower bound being a lowest number of objects that can be contained in the associated shape.
